Top Ruff Life Pet Hotel | Reviews & Ratings | comparemela.com
Ruff life pet hotel in United states - 49770/ near petoskey/ near emmet
Ruff life pet hotel in United states - 60030/ near lake
Ruff life pet hotel in United states - 49770/ near emmet
Ruff life pet hotel in United states - 17406/ near york